DVWAP Overlay Indicator

The DVWAP Overlay is a custom TradingView indicator designed to track Volume-Weighted Average Price (VWAP) levels over different time periods and visualize untapped VWAP levels on the price chart. It also includes historical VWAP tracking, which helps traders identify key support and resistance levels.
Key Features & Functionality
1. User Inputs & Settings
Text Size Selection: Allows users to choose the text size for labels (Tiny, Small, Normal, Large).
VWAP Display Options:
Option to show/hide VWAP levels.
Option to display Naked VWAP levels, meaning VWAP levels that have not been touched by price yet.
Color Customization: Users can configure colors for VWAP lines and labels.
2. VWAP Calculation & Plotting
Daily VWAP Calculation: The script calculates the VWAP for each daily session, adjusting at the start of a new day.
Standard Deviation Bands: The script also calculates the VWAP deviation (similar to Bollinger Bands).
Plotting VWAP: A line is drawn on the chart to visualize VWAP levels for the current and past sessions.
3. Untapped VWAP Level Tracking
The indicator keeps track of VWAP levels that have not yet been touched by price.
If price crosses a previous VWAP level, it is removed from the chart.
These untouched levels are highlighted and labeled on the chart.
4. Historical VWAP Levels
The indicator stores and plots previous VWAP levels, helping traders identify key historical price zones.
Two types of historical VWAPs are displayed:
Previous day VWAP (pdVWAP)
Historical Naked VWAP levels (nVWAP)
How Traders Can Use This Indicator
✅ Support & Resistance Identification: Helps traders find key VWAP levels that can act as support/resistance.
✅ Breakout & Rejection Trades: If price approaches an untouched VWAP, it could indicate a potential reaction.
✅ Institutional Order Flow Tracking: VWAP is often used by institutions for volume-based trade execution.
